■Checking the Oil
We recommend that you check the engine oil level every time you refuel.
- Bring up the
Oil Level Check Assist display on the
Driver Information Interface.
- Warm up the engine until all the bars in the
Warm Up gauge light up.
- When the bars turn green, park the vehicle on level ground and select Park (P).
- Allow the engine to continue idling until all the bars in the
Idle Time gauge in the engine
Oil Level Check Assist display light up. Do not depress the accelerator pedal while the engine is idling, as this will reset the
Idle Time.
- When all the bars in the Idle Time gauge light up,
Ready To Check Oil Level message appears.
- Change the display in the Driver Information Interface to any display other than the
Oil Level Check Assist display.
- Change the power mode to VEHICLE OFF.
- Open the
hatch. (See
Opening the Hood) Remove the right engine compartment cover. Remove the dipstick (orange).
- Wipe the dipstick with a clean cloth or paper towel.
- Insert the dipstick all the way back into its hole.
- Remove the dipstick again, and check the level. It should be between the upper and lower marks.
Add oil if necessary.
- After checking the engine oil level, make sure to select a display other than the
Oil Level Check Assist display.
